Connell Brothers, a division of Wilbur-Ellis Company and the largest marketer and distributor of speciality chemicals and industrial ingredients in Asia Pacific, has opened a technical and training centre in Guangzhou, China.
The centre will support the commercial and technical needs of customers in coatings and ink, food and personal care, in the South China market.
It will offer application development, formulations and testing, together with hands-on lab and classroom training for customers, suppliers and employees.
"This important investment is one of several planned across the region in line with our growth strategy,” said Azita Owlia, VP of North Asia. "We have an aggressive investment plan geared to ensure comprehensive market reach throughout North Asia for the speciality chemicals markets we serve.”
Connell Brothers also recently opened a newly expanded office in the Republic of Korea including an application laboratory specific for the personal care segment.
